Function
Description
X-PRST-NAME?
Get the name of a
preset per type.
this is an extended
preset command using
preset type as first
parameter. This is
used essentially when
we have different types
of Presets inside the
same system.
To get the list of preset
types existing in your
product use the
command:
X-PRST-TYPES?
This is an Extended
Protocol 3000
command.
X-PRST-RCL
Recall saved preset list
per type.

X-PRST-RCL-
Recall LAST preset
LAST
per type, this
command just
retrieves the last
preset loaded from the
history of preset
activity and RECALLs
it.

X-PRST-RCL-
Recall NEXT preset
NEXT
per type, this
command increments
by one the current
preset id loaded and
loads it. If the index is
the highest, recall will
fail.

AFM-20DSP – Protocol 3000
Syntax
COMMAND
#X-PRST-NAME?preset_type,preset_id,name<CR>
FEEDBACK
~nn@X-PRST-NAMEpreset_type,preset_id,name<CR><LF>
COMMAND
#X-PRST-RCLpreset_type,preset_id<CR>
FEEDBACK
~nn@X-PRST-RCLpreset_type,preset_id<CR><LF>
COMMAND
#X-PRST-RCL-LASTpreset_type
FEEDBACK
~nn@X-PRST-RCL-LASTpreset_type,preset_id<CR><LF>
COMMAND
#X-PRST-RCL-NEXTpreset_type<CR>
FEEDBACK
~nn@X-PRST-RCL-NEXTpreset_type,preset_id<CR><LF>

Get the name of a preset (per
type):
X-PRST-
NAME?IOCONFIG.SYSTEM.M
IXER,9<CR>
~01@X-PRST-
NAME?IOConfig.SYSTEM.M
IXER,9,Room1<CR><LF>
Recall mixer preset 8:
X-PRST-
RCL?IOCONFIG.SYSTEM.MI
XER,8<CR>
Recall the last mixer preset:
X-PRST-RCL-
LASTIOCONFIG.SYSTEM.MI
XER<CR>
Recall next mixer preset:
X-PRST-RCL-
NEXTIOCONFIG.SYSTEM.MI
XER<CR>
